While small, Reston Train Station is designed to cater to the essential needs of travellers. There's no ticket office, but you'll find user-friendly ticket machines available, which are also accessible to everyone. You can conveniently collect tickets purchased online from these machines. Additionally, a smartcard validator is in place for hassle-free validation of travel cards.
Reston is a step-free station, ensuring easy navigation for all passengers. Although there are no staffed help points, the station is equipped with an induction loop for hearing assistance, and there's CCTV for added safety. Even though the station doesn't boast a waiting room or restrooms, it's part of the larger network offering assistance booking via Passenger Assist; learn more here.

Despite its unassuming nature, Heworth Station provides some basic amenities. There is no manned ticket office, but passengers can easily buy and collect pre-purchased tickets using the available ticket machines, which are fully accessible. The station is categorized as a Category B Station, meaning that while it is unstaffed, it has ramped access to platforms, ensuring wheelchair users and those with mobility impairments can navigate without issues. However, do note that facilities like to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ment services, and bicycle storage are lacking, perhaps making it more of a transit point than a hangout location.
Though CCTV is not present, there are customer help points scattered throughout the station to ensure assistance is just a call away, offering a sense of security and support to travelers. For those seeking additional help, the conductor on the arriving train is available to assist with boarding and disembarking needs. Heworth station seamlessly integrates with multiple transport options, making it a pivotal access point for further travel. The nearby Tyne and Wear Metro station means that reaching local destinations is convenient. Should you need a taxi, the service can be arranged via platforms like Cab4You, helping to ensure stress-free onward journeys. However, bus services are less accessible immediately around the station, so some forward planning is advisable. For any queries, travelers can connect with Busline at 0871 200 2233.
